Marina Inn - Budget-friendly bed and breakfast near Fisherman's Wharf
Located in San Francisco's Marina District, Marina Inn is a historic property built in 1924, offering modern amenities in a budget-friendly setting. The hotel provides easy access to Fisherman's Wharf, Ghirardelli Square, and the Golden Gate Bridge. Amenities include complimentary continental breakfast, 24-hour front desk, free Wi-Fi, and an elevator. The property is ADA accessible with features like wheelchair-accessible rooms and Braille signage. Nearby attractions include Union Square, Alcatraz Island, and the Asian Art Museum.

Rooms
Marina Inn offers 40 guest rooms with Queen beds or Queen beds with day beds. Rooms feature English country-style decor with floral wallpaper and pine beds. All rooms include private bathrooms, free Wi-Fi, and cable TV. Some rooms have bay windows. ADA accessible rooms are available with features like wheelchair-accessible doorways and bathrooms with grab bars.
